Formulation Basics: How Inactive Ingredients Support Biologically Active Components
If you ask a pharmacist what makes a medication work, they'll talk about the Active pharmaceutical ingredient, often shortened to API. That is the molecule with the therapeutic consequence. But whenever you ask a formulator why the drugs works reliably for authentic other people, dose after dose, they will commence naming the unsung partners around the API. Those are the so‑known as inactive parts, additionally which is called excipients. They do not deal with the disorder immediately, but they determine whether a capsule dissolves in 3 mins or thirty, whether a protein holds its structure using summer delivery, and whether a boy or girl will receive a moment spoonful of a sour syrup.
Here is the means gurus consider About active and inactive treatment constituents. The API is the protagonist, the biologically active element in medicines. The excipients are the group that units the stage, runs the lights, and retains the show on agenda. Leave out the workforce, and the display would on no account open.
Why the “inactive” label misleads
I even have noticed excipients make or break a assignment. A poorly soluble, promising molecule can underperform in folks except a tiny quantity of surfactant lifts its dissolution price. A good tablet can leap failing a yr after launch while the lubricant level, risk free in process trials, slows disintegration in a humid warehouse. For years we used the time period inactive as a legal and regulatory shorthand. It does no longer suggest inert. It capability they may be not meant to have a therapeutic effect on the labeled dose.
Think about lactose. It appears to be like humble, and it in the main is, yet pair it with a foremost amine inside the API, upload moisture and time, and you could trigger Maillard browning. The tablet features a yellow tint and loses potency. Or take magnesium stearate, a workhorse lubricant. It smooths compression, yet too much or too long inside the blender can coat debris so good that water won't be able to wet them, and dissolution slows. A mere 0.25 p.c. trade can shift a liberate profile. The crew things.
The imperative jobs excipients do
Excipients aid 4 wide wishes. They make drug treatments manufacturable, strong, bioavailable, and usable by using patients. Under those banners, they serve as fillers, binders, disintegrants, lubricants, glidants, coatings, solvents, surfactants, buffers, preservatives, antioxidants, chelators, sweeteners, flavors, hues, plasticizers, and more. The equal component can take on varied roles based on context.
-
Make drugs and drugs manufacturable. Diluents like lactose, microcrystalline cellulose, or mannitol construct bulk when an API dose is tiny. Binders such as povidone, starch paste, or HPMC hold granules together. Lubricants like magnesium stearate or sodium stearyl fumarate end powder from sticking to punches. Glidants like colloidal silica beef up stream so the die fills evenly. A two‑milligram dose of a powerful API will not combination or pass effectively by myself. Without a diluent, you will not reach content uniformity at a press pace of two hundred,000 tablets in keeping with hour.
-
Stabilize the API via manufacturing and shelf existence. Buffers and pH adjusters keep the microenvironment close a cost wherein the API is less likely to hydrolysis. Antioxidants like ascorbic acid, sodium metabisulfite, or BHT scavenge radicals. Chelators like EDTA tie up trace metals that catalyze oxidation. Moisture scavengers, desiccants, and movie coatings defend hygroscopic drugs from ambient humidity. In biologics, sugars like trehalose or sucrose shield proteins all the way through freeze drying through replacing water in hydrogen bonding networks.
-
Enable drug launch and absorption. Disintegrants corresponding to croscarmellose sodium or crospovidone swell directly in water and destroy a tablet into granules. Surfactants like sodium lauryl sulfate guide moist hydrophobic surfaces and can enhance the dissolution of BCS Class II compounds. Polymers akin to HPMC Acetate Succinate can style amorphous sturdy dispersions with poorly soluble APIs, expanding obvious solubility and publicity. Coatings depending on methacrylate copolymers can resist stomach acid and liberate in the intestine, overlaying acid‑labile APIs or concentrating on local movement.
-
Improve adherence. Taste overlaying with flavors, sweeteners like sucralose or sorbitol, and film coatings can turn a sour drug into a suitable medicine. Orally disintegrating tablet matrices with mannitol and occasional stages of superdisintegrant allow tablets that melt at the tongue in under 30 seconds. Colors assist sufferers distinguish strengths and preclude dosing mistakes. Viscosity modifiers in liquids, like glycerin or xanthan gum, upgrade mouthfeel and suspend particles frivolously so the first and last teaspoon in shape.
These roles overlap. The paintings is picking combinations that play nicely together, with the API, with manufacturing appliance, and with each one other.
A rapid excursion of universal excipients and the way they earn their keep
Diluents. Lactose is a classic for direct compression, with tremendous compressibility. Mannitol cools at the tongue, effectual in chewables and ODTs, and it resists Maillard reactions. Microcrystalline cellulose (MCC) binds and dilutes instantaneously, yet it attracts water, which will probably be a hardship for moisture‑sensitive APIs.
Binders. Polyvinylpyrrolidone (PVP, povidone) is flexible, soluble, and forms hard granules. Hydroxypropyl cellulose is also extra dry or as a solution. Too a whole lot binder raises pill hardness and slows disintegration. If your dissolution slows for the duration of scale‑up, look at various binder focus and solvent content for your moist granulation step.
Disintegrants. Croscarmellose sodium and sodium starch glycolate swell hastily. Crospovidone wicks water and works effectively at reduce use degrees, regularly 1 to 3 %. Placement issues. Intragrannular addition supports long lasting granules that still fall apart rapid. Extragranular addition boosts surface movement. A combine of both basically beats either on my own.
Lubricants and glidants. Magnesium stearate is king, used at zero.25 to one percentage. It can over‑lubricate if mixed too lengthy, hurting dissolution. Sodium stearyl fumarate has a gentler end result on dissolution profiles and is impressive in moisture‑touchy techniques. Colloidal silica at zero.1 to zero.5 percent reduces inter‑particle friction and improves die fill, particularly for cohesive APIs.
Coatings. HPMC‑established movie coats with plasticizers like PEG or triacetin guard pills from abrasion and humidity, and mask flavor. Enteric coatings like cellulose acetate phthalate, HPMCAS, or methacrylic acid copolymers extend release till pH rises above a cause value, repeatedly around pH five.5 to 7. Coating thickness goals, at the order of 40 to 120 microns, are tighter than they appear. Ten microns extra can adjust lag time to dissolution by way of minutes.
Solvents and cosolvents. In beverages, ethanol, propylene glycol, glycerin, and PEG 400 solubilize API. Watch age corporations. Propylene glycol and benzyl alcohol have toxicity issues in neonates. A pediatric components would possibly rely upon glycerin and sorbitol answer instead, paired with a preservative procedure proven by a pharmacopoeial efficacy try.
Surfactants. Sodium lauryl sulfate improves wetting and dissolution of hydrophobic powders. Polysorbates 20 or eighty stabilize proteins with the aid of stopping aggregation at interfaces yet can degrade to peroxides that oxidize methionine residues. Monitor peroxide content material and accept as true with antioxidants or preference surfactants like poloxamers.
Buffers and pH adjusters. Citrates, acetates, phosphates, and tromethamine keep pH home windows. Microenvironment pH shall be tuned in a cast dosage style by using embedding the right buffer round granules. Less than 2 percent of a microenvironmental buffer can swing a regional pH unit and protect an acid‑delicate API with the aid of the abdomen.
Stabilizers for proteins. Sugars like trehalose, polyols like mannitol, amino acids like histidine, and surfactants like polysorbate all chip in. I once labored on a monoclonal antibody where a shift from phosphate to histidine buffer cut subvisible debris by part after 3 months at forty C, not since phosphate became “undesirable,” however for the reason that the histidine, at the properly ionic capability, became gentler below agitation and heat.
Preservatives. Parabens, sodium benzoate, potassium sorbate, benzalkonium chloride in ophthalmics, phenol in a few injectables. They stabilize multi‑dose products, however additionally they hold allergenicity and age regulations. Regulatory steering pushes for the minimal triumphant degree, and you turn out that with preservative efficacy testing over 28 days.
Sweeteners, flavors, and colorings. The half patients become aware of. Sucralose and acesulfame potassium advance sweetness devoid of fermenting on the shelf. Flavors come in many oil and water soluble bases, and compatibility with different excipients matters. I actually have considered orange style oils solubilize a polymer coat and lift impurity levels. Colors are regulated by way of location and type. An iron oxide this is advantageous for a pill would possibly not be authorised in an eye drop.
Routes of transport amendment the playbook
An oral reliable dose has one set of actions. An ODT components of a bitter antihistamine may perhaps use mannitol, crospovidone, and a movie coat that dissolves directly, whilst maintaining magnesium stearate low and blend instances short. Bioavailability hinges on instant wetting and breakup in saliva, taste masking, and maintaining the pill powerful adequate for a bottling line. You objective disintegration below 30 seconds and a hardness that survives a drop try out.
For poorly soluble APIs, amorphous good dispersions made by way of sizzling melt extrusion with polymers like PVP‑VA or HPMCAS can soar exposure numerous fold. You may possibly add a surfactant like SLS at zero.five to one % to support wetting. It will carry Cmax, yet it could also introduce flavor and irritancy. If the dose is top, the polymer load becomes gigantic, and capsule fill weight balloons. That is a industry‑off you weigh towards salt determination and particle engineering.
Controlled or certain launch differences the palette. Osmotic pump pills use cellulose acetate membranes and a drilled orifice to launch at 0 order. Matrix tablets depend on HPMC grades that gel and manage erosion. Coated multiparticulates use ethylcellulose to slow diffusion. With every single, excipient particle length distribution and viscosity grade consistency subject. One HPMC lot that gels swifter can pull a unlock curve out of spec. Your provider’s variability is your variability.
Liquids deliver microbial chance. A pediatric syrup have got to steadiness sweetness, osmolality, viscosity, and preservative machine. A common recipe may well incorporate 60 to 70 p.c sorbitol answer and glycerin for body, sucrose or sucralose for flavor, sodium benzoate with a citrate buffer at pH round 4.five for upkeep, plus taste and coloration. The preservative works simplest if the pH and unfastened water endeavor remain in stove throughout the shelf life. If an API is weakly elementary and drifts pH upward through the years, preservative efficacy can slip. Packaging with a vented cap can let CO2 break out and pH creep. You watch it in stability.
Parenterals present cleanliness and reticence. A small set of excipients is suitable by using injection. You may see histidine buffer at 10 to 20 mM, trehalose at 50 to one hundred mM, polysorbate eighty at zero.01 to zero.1 percentage. Every one is scrutinized. Polysorbate degradation to fatty acids can sort particles with stainless steel laying off inside the fill line. You specify low peroxide grades and control stainless contact. Even silicone oil used to coat syringes can induce protein aggregation at the interface. Changing a syringe corporation can also be a formula swap in disguise.
Inhalation adds aerodynamic performance. Lactose monohydrate inside the 50 to 200 micron vary in most cases acts as service in dry powder inhalers. The API adheres to the provider in the instrument, then detaches for the time of inhalation to carry respirable particles, quite often beneath five microns aerodynamic diameter. Surface electricity of the lactose, managed by using milling and conditioning, determines how honestly the API detaches. A swap in lactose organisation can halve high quality particle dose, regardless of matching certificates data, due to the fact that the floor profile and minor impurities range.
Topical and transdermal merchandise stay or die with the aid of rheology and permeation. Emulsifiers set droplet size and stability. Humectants like propylene glycol ease software and adorn penetration, yet they're able to sting damaged skin. Carbomers construct yield strain so a cream does now not run, but you will have to neutralize them with the perfect base. Too a good deal triethanolamine can yellow over time. Additives like oleic acid can raise flux by pores and skin but could also aggravate. These change‑offs do now not coach up on a whiteboard. You learn them by using patch checks and affected person suggestions.
How formulators decide upon wisely
You do not commence with a great menu. You birth with the API’s liabilities and the product’s ambitions. Is it a susceptible base with negative solubility in impartial pH, supposed for once‑day by day dosing? Think pH modifiers, polymers that hold supersaturation, and a sustained unlock matrix. Is it a peptide that falls aside at interfaces? Think mushy buffers, sugars, surfactants with low peroxide, and interfaces minimized by way of vial headspace and silicone control.
Regulatory precedent matters. The FDA’s Inactive Ingredient Database exhibits what excipients and levels have been used effectively in authorised products with the aid of direction. If you see crospovidone at five percentage in dozens of oral drugs, that lowers your threat. For a singular excipient or a new use degree, you need toxicology, and timelines stretch. For over‑the‑counter merchandise, shade and flavor chances narrow through monograph.
Supply chain is not really a footnote. Pharmacopeial grades are not equivalent across distributors. Different compendial masses of the equal nominal grade can compress in a different way. I know a company that had to revalidate whilst their favored MCC grade went on allocation. The new dealer’s drapery met USP assessments yet produced softer drugs on the identical compression force. They needed to boost drive, which raised capping threat. A week of small variations become a month of experiments. Qualify secondary suppliers early, or you are going to be doing engineering trials within the midsection of a backorder.
Compatibility can shock you. Maillard reactions among slicing sugars and commonly used or secondary amines should be gradual and sophisticated, then accelerate in summer season storage. Excipients can disguise hint nitrite that contributes to nitrosamine hazard in the event that your API has a prone amine. Surfactants can extract plasticizers out of tubing. A dye can catalyze photolysis. The solution is absolutely not paranoia, but a designed set of monitors. A dozen binary mixtures at 40 C and seventy five p.c relative humidity for 2 to four weeks, followed by HPLC and eye tests, will trap such a lot immediate movers. Differential scanning calorimetry is helping spot reliable state incompatibilities. A small up‑entrance spend averts widespread late anguish.
Patient aspects you can't ignore
Inactive elements aren't invisible to patients. Lactose in a capsule can set off affliction in the lactose intolerant, however the quantities are recurrently small. A gluten sensitive patient would fret about starch assets. Dyes can result in reactions in a subset of folk. Benzyl alcohol has exact warnings for neonates. Propylene glycol has ended in toxicity whilst used liberally in pediatric products. Preservatives in eye drops can purpose floor infection with continual use. If your audience is pediatric, geriatric, or delicate, decide upon excipients with that during brain. When you won't be able to sidestep a contentious excipient, communicate simply and layout packaging to make dosing as ordinary as one could.
Adherence ties to sensory knowledge as a great deal as to pharmacology. I as soon as watched a flavor panel of adults grimace via an unmasked antibiotic suspension. The moment run, with the similar API and a thoughtful taste and sweetener blend, scored five aspects top on a nine factor scale. The change used to be bedtime compliance in a feverish baby.
Manufacturing steers many decisions
It is simple to assume in phrases of job households. Direct compression is the simplest trail. If your mixture flows, compresses, and dissolves without fuss, you might have the shortest path to marketplace. MCC plus a superdisintegrant and a little bit of lubricant can elevate many APIs. But direct compression is unforgiving of poor move and content uniformity.
Wet granulation can tame fines and strengthen compressibility. It adds steps, solvent dealing with, and drying. Binder selection and solvent degree form granule density and porosity, which in flip form dissolution. A switch from top shear to fluid bed granulation variations shear exposure and solvent evaporation premiums. You won't simply elevate over a binder resolution point and expect matching habits.
Dry granulation by means of curler compaction saves heat and solvent yet can over‑densify and decrease dissolution when you are not careful. It additionally stresses debris. Fragile crystals can ruin and amendment their floor area, affecting content material uniformity and steadiness. If your API is polymorphic, pay consideration. A compacting step can push a kind change, with the intention to display up as a waft in dissolution or whilst seen speckling in a coated pill.
Analytical keep an eye on closes the loop. You do not bet at bioavailability. You degree particle length, stable state style by XRPD, thermal behavior by means of DSC, dissolution throughout pH, and rheology for liquids. You monitor mix uniformity, capsule hardness, friability, disintegration, and dissolution. Many a line commence has been kept via a standard in‑line close infrared payment on moisture after fluid mattress drying.
Real examples from the bench and the plant
A BCS Class II analgesic with a 2 hundred mg dose seemed advantageous on paper. The first medical batch showed erratic exposure. When we checked, capsule cores have been hydrophobic satisfactory that they took two mins to moist in a static dissolution bathtub. We delivered zero.5 % sodium lauryl sulfate to the extragranular blend and switched 20 p.c. of the lactose to mannitol to reduce the microenvironment Maillard chance. Wetting time fell to under 30 seconds, and publicity tightness advanced. Patients suggested a slight aftertaste. We fastened that with a just a little thicker film coat and a mint taste in the coat. The closing tweak fastened a patient situation with out touching the release profile or the regulatory story.
A monoclonal antibody in a prefilled syringe carried a visible particle threat in winter transport, traced to agitation plus silicone oil microdroplets. We diminished headspace, switched to low‑silicone coated barrels, delivered a zero.02 % polysorbate eighty with a outlined low peroxide spec, and moved from phosphate to histidine buffer. Subvisible counts by way of MFI dropped via approximately 50 percent at three months in rigidity testing, and sufferer lawsuits fell.
A pediatric antibiotic suspension failed preservative efficacy on the quit of shelf life in a scorching local weather. The sodium benzoate stage was once textbook, however the pH had crept above 5.five resulting from sluggish base leaching from the sweetener combination. We introduced a citrate buffer and tightened the pH objective window. We also replaced the cap liner to restrict CO2 replace. The 2d run passed the pharmacopoeial try out across temperatures, and style checks stayed favorable.
Risk control and good quality through design
Modern formulas work is chance work. You map necessary good quality attributes, like dissolution profile, assay, impurities, and content material uniformity. You name which method aspects, like disintegrant level, lubricant combine time, and polymer grade, cross those attributes. You use small factorial designs to build response surfaces. An excess day of design of experiments now will shop months of guessing later. Regulators expect this rigor. The language of ICH Q8, Q9, and Q10 is the comparable language you operate to sleep at night time. A described layout area around excipient levels, blending times, and coating parameters affords you room to head while a company ameliorations or while kit enhancements occur.
Nitrosamines made every formulator reevaluate. Excipients carry trace nitrites. APIs lift amines. Under the properly conditions, you will shape nitrosamines in a complete product. Even if you happen to circumvent nitrosatable APIs, you continue to monitor excipients for nitrite ranges, push providers for controls, and use antioxidants or chelators when justified. A probability contrast that ties your drapery choices to analytical documents is part of the recent original.
Navigating regulations and precedent
When a brand new molecule arrives, we ask, what are the expectations by way of route and region. The FDA’s Inactive Ingredient Database is a regularly occurring prevent. If you want 2 p.c. polysorbate eighty in an injectable, and the IID exhibits natural use levels beneath zero.1 p.c, you understand you are in for additonal justification. For oral drugs, in the event you would like to take advantage of a unique polymer in a controlled unencumber coat, toxicology and a communication with regulators could also be valuable. Most teams select well known excipients for speed, booking novelty for whilst the API leaves no other trail.
GRAS popularity in meals does now not translate one to one into drug use. Routes, doses, and context count. Even within medicines, an eye drop will have a exclusive tolerance for excipients than a tablet. Your pattern plan reads greater easily while it leans on what has been achieved before, and your documentation presentations you understand the sides.

Edge situations well worth respect
A few circumstances defy the standard regulation. Some APIs double as excipients in other contexts. At low phases, menthol will likely be a flavor, at increased stages that's lively. The line is the label claim and the dose. Some excipients transform functionally very important to bioavailability, elevating questions in bioequivalence when customary firms choose assorted services. For controlled unencumber products, the excipient matrix will probably be the intellectual assets. A swap from one HPMC grade to yet one more may possibly seem trivial on paper and yet holiday equivalence in vivo on the grounds that gel dynamics range in the intestine.
Another facet case that catches teams unprepared is excipient ageing. Peroxide phases in polysorbates rise in warm garage. Trace aldehydes can acquire in distinct flavors. Moisture content in MCC shifts seasonally. If your system uses up the small defense margin among a suitable impurity point and a failing one, a season or a organisation exchange can push you out of spec. You secure yourself by putting incoming specifications that mirror system truth, not simply pharmacopeial minima.
